State and federal emergency teams inspected damage to homes and other structures after two tornadoes hit Pulaski County on Friday. FEMA has determined that 267 homes were damaged to some extent with 31 of them destroyed. Building inspectors are now working to determine which of the homes are safe to live in, and which should be condemned. FEMA says it plans to remain in the Pulaski area as long as its crews are needed. The inspection teams are sending their assessment to Governor Bob McDonnell who may then request federal disaster aid.
